Updated on 2025-08-26 GMT+08:00

IMS Operations Audited by CTS

Scenarios

Cloud Trace Service (CTS) is a log audit service provided by Huawei Cloud and intended for cloud security. It allows you to collect, store, and query cloud resource operation records and use these records for security analysis, compliance auditing, resource tracking, and fault locating.

You can use CTS to record IMS operations for later querying, auditing, and backtracking.

Prerequisites

You need to enable CTS before using it. If it is not enabled, IMS operations cannot be recorded. After being enabled, CTS automatically creates a tracker to record all your operations. The tracker stores only the operations of the last seven days. To store the operations for a longer time, store trace files in OBS buckets.

IMS Operations Recorded by CTS

Table 1 IMS operations that can be recorded by CTS

Operation

Resource Type

Trace Name

Creating an image

ims

createImage

Creating a data disk image

ims

createDataImage

Creating a full-ECS image

ims

createWholeImage

Modifying an image

ims

updateImage

Deleting images in a batch

ims

deleteImage

Querying details about an image

ims

queryImage

Querying details about images

ims

listImages

Replicating an image

ims

copyImage

Replicating an image across regions

ims

crossRegionCopyImage

Exporting an image

ims

exportImage

Adding a member

ims

addMember

Modifying members in a batch

ims

updateMember

Deleting members in a batch

ims

deleteMember

Querying details about a member

ims

queryMember

Querying details about members

ims

listMembers

Adding or modifying an image tag

ims

createOrUpdateTags

Adding or deleting image tags in a batch

ims

batchAddOrDeleteImageTag

Adding an image tag

ims

createTag

Deleting image tags in a batch

ims

deleteTags

Deleting an image tag

ims

deleteTag

Querying image tags

ims

listTags

Creating image metadata

ims

createImageMetadata

Register an image file as a private image

ims

registerImage

Uploading an image

ims

uploadImage

Querying an image schema

ims

queryImageSchema

Querying an image list schema

ims

queryImageListSchema

Querying an image member schema

ims

queryMemberSchema

Querying an image member list schema

ims

queryMemberListSchema

Querying OSs supported by images

ims

listOsVersions

Querying image quotas

ims

queryImageQuota

Table 2 Relationship between IMS operations and native OpenStack APIs

Operation

Trace Name

Service Type

Resource Type

OpenStack Component

Creating an Image

createImage

IMS

image

glance

Modifying/Uploading an image

updateImage

IMS

image

glance

Deleting an image

deleteImage

IMS

image

glance

Tagging an image

addTag

IMS

image

glance

Deleting an image tag

deleteTag

IMS

image

glance

Adding a tenant that can use a shared image

addMember

IMS

image

glance

Modifying information about a tenant that can use a shared image

updateMember

IMS

image

glance

Deleting a tenant from the group where the members can use a shared image

deleteMember

IMS

image

glance